The Imperial (2x 14 floors, due 2006)
Location: Jln Rumbia/River Valley Road
Total No. of Units: 187 Tenure: Freehold Expected TOP: 26 March 2006 Developer: Imperial Realty Ltd. Description : Condominium development with 2 basement carparks and other ancillary facilities.
